CarComplaints.com Notes: The 2014 (and 2015) Jeep Grand Cherokee have a serious defect trend of transmission complaints. Most of the complaints are for rough shifting — things like jerking & hesitation when shifting gears.

The contact owns a 2014 Jeep grand Cherokee. The contact stated that the dashboard was coming apart which could hinder the deployment of the air bag in the event of a crash. The vehicle was diagnosed but not repaired. The manufacturer was not informed of the failure. The failure mileage was approximately 80,000.

The contact owns a 2014 Jeep Grand Cherokee. The contact stated while the vehicle was stationary, the dashboard bubbled and wrinkled and started to fall apart. The vehicle was taken to burns motors (1300 E U.S. highway 83, business, mcallen, tx 78501) where it was diagnosed with the dashboard needing to be replaced. The vehicle was not repaired. The contact linked the failure to an unknown recall. The manufacturer had not been informed of the failure. The failure mileage was unknown.
